I should clarify something. I'm not talking about a manual J load calculation. I'm talking about the load calculation based on furnace runtime when we had multiple instances of -10 to -20f temperatures outside and then calculated to a 'per degree' value. These are actual load values. This is why I'm so confident that a 40k condensing furnace could do the job in my 2100 sq ft house because the 75k 76% furnace(57k output) doesn't even run half the time when it is at design temp.
